Industrial Dance is a both a style of music and dance. The term “Industrial Dance” is a North American phrase which derives from Electric Body Music (EBM). It is a sub genre of Industrial music which, as opposed to 1970’s-1980’s experimental electronic rock music, is focused on a dance rhythm. The terms “Industrial” to describe music relates to music that was a part of Industrial Records, a record label. There was an album released called: Industrial music for industrial people. It was a musical movement that was a music spin on punk, more rebellious than the traditional mainstream rebellion. There were heavy uses of totalitarianism in imagery, songs and performances. Some early bands in this genre include Throbbing Gristle, Einst?�A�rzende Neubauten and SPK.
As time progressed, the music in this movement began to include more of a danceable beat. One influential band in this transition was Front 242. Their music was somewhat dance-able while still maintaining the darker themes, they used electronic elements more heavily and it was less experimental in terms of instrument choices. Over time other bands ventured into this realm of Industrial Dance and were commonly labeled as Electro-Industrial. These bands include Wumpscut, Leather Strip, Skinny Puppy and others. This movement was in the early 1990’s in Europe and somewhat in America.
Over time, in the later 1990’s to early 2000’s bands like Funker Vogt, Terrorfakt, Hocico and Accessory came to be. They were more beat focused and driven. This was a shift from experimental jazz-like music from the 1970’s because it was less oriented around live performances and more oriented around body beats. As the early 2000’s to mid 2000’s came about, bands such as Combichrist emerged. They were even considered to be by some a new genre, harsh-EBM.
While the styles of changed, rave oriented influences started to enter the genre and in the late 2000’s and early 2010’s we find bands like FGFC820, [X-RX], Aesthetic Perfection, Faderhead, T3RR0R 3RR0R and more. While not every song these bands make fall into the Industrial Dance category, they have become what it is mostly these days.
As for the dance style, this is a difficult subject to research. Some would point to articles that emerged in early 2000’s on how to dance like a rivethead. Some people point to LA, Chicago or Germany for the dance style itself. Most noticeably the dance style has become popularized by YouTube. Back in 2006 a video was uploaded to the song War by Wumpscut which included someone wearing a gas mask dancing in their parent’s house. From there different videos were released which actually include a slightly different dance style but are called Industrial Dance.
There are many popular industrial dancers today as industrial dance videos have become a form of user generated content/ fan video Types Of Business Services Introduction for creative industrial music fans. Some popular dancers on YouTube include: tank9, dtoksick, Eisschrei, xxxaleeraxxx, and others.

Reduce Supply Chain Costs – 10 Ways to Save Energy and Cut Waste
1. Use long life fluorescent bulbs and lamps. Long life fluorescent lamps require Customized Manufacturing System changing less frequently which will reduce labor costs over the bulbs lifespan.
2. Regular light bulbs can be replaced by more energy efficient compact fluorescent bulbs that yield the same amount and quality of light while reducing energy costs.
3. Replace lighting fixtures with newer energy efficient fixtures. Example: Replace 400 watt metal-halide light fixtures with T8 fluorescent bay fixtures.
4. Alternative lighting solutions provide serious energy savings in a short amount of time. Perform lighting audits to calculate energy saving opportunities from specific upgrades.
5. Think outside the box when expediting transportation of replacement parts. Contact the factory directly for replacement parts and arrange for speedy alternative transportation of needed parts to reduce down time on production lines.
6. Out service your competitors by reducing customer down time due to late deliveries.
7. Track ordering activity. Scrutinize automatic purchase requisitions and determine if the items are really needed when ordered.
8. Outsourcing of inventory control with keep-fill program helps regulate supplies, and takes the burden off plant personnel freeing them up to do more productive duties.
9. Reduce training costs by arranging for employees to be trained on processes from suppliers providing product. Lighting Industry For instance, suppliers of fuse boxes could be asked to train mechanics on servicing the new boxes.
10. Take advantage of special offers made by suppliers for free services like training, storage cabinets, etc.

Who Regulates the Gambling Regulators?
The current phase of regulation of the gambling market in EU jurisdictions is now almost over. Following the Spanish Gambling Regulation Act reaching the statute book, there is only one big jurisdiction left which has not yet regulated its gambling industry according to the EU legislation and European Commission (EC) directives – Germany. Other jurisdictions, such as Greece and Denmark, have yet to complete their journey to regulation, but they are not that far from the finishing line.
It is no secret that many countries were pushed into changing their legislation by court cases brought by commercial operators and infringements proceedings started by the EC. It is not too much of an exaggeration to say that some governments had to be dragged kicking and screaming to allow private operators into the national gambling market. Many countries did the minimum amount that was sufficient to stop EU infringement proceedings Manufacturing Engineer Jobs and designed regulatory frameworks that favoured, if not outright protected, their state-owned gambling monopolies. Additionally, just to make sure that commercial operators are not too successful, these same governments also imposed a high tax rate. France is a classic case study of this course of action and to a certain extent Spain and Greece are following French footsteps. Germany cannot bring itself to walk even that far.
Within this mix, regulators are given a wide remit to keep a check on commercial operators. ARJEL in France is fairly aggressive in making sure that commercial operators do not infringe the regulations, and even more aggressive with those who do not obtain a French licence but who continue to operate in France.
The role of regulators has up to now not been sufficiently analysed. Are they independent entities who regulate the market, similar to a Financial Services Authority or a Central Bank for the financial sector? Or are regulators in the gambling industry solely an arm of the country’s executive?
So far, the pattern of behaviour of gambling regulators leads observers to think that they act more like the arm of governments than independent referees.
Where state-owned gambling operators have a large market share and are protected by law from competition in certain sectors like lotteries, the behaviour of regulators tends to be important, not only as a matter of fairness, but from the point of view of enabling a truly competitive market. There is something wrong when the state controls the biggest firm or firms in the market and at the same time makes the rules through the regulator.
France is the case in point. The state controlled PMU and FDJ’s dominant position in land-based gambling activities (where they are protected by law) allowed them to gain a competitive advantage in online activities, even thought the law states they have to separate their land-based and online businesses. Why Promotional Pens and Printed Pens Are Rarely Made in the West Any More
Europe and North America have unrivalled pedigrees as far as pen manufacturing goes but in recent years their high manufacturing costs has meant that the majority of unbranded pens have now switched to India, Korea or China. This is particularly true of promotional pens and printed pens because they tend to be price-sensitive commodities. This article looks at how this change has taken place.
We are all familiar with the top-brand pens such as Parker, Waterman, Cross, Sheaffer and Mont Blanc. These are pens that are traditionally made in western countries and that is still largely true today because their premium prices and consequent high margins has less reliance on low manufacturing costs. However, in recent years we are beginning to see Asian plants appearing to either manufacture components for some of these brands and in some cases Mechanical Industrial Safety Ppt the entire pen itself. In the latter case this is primarily to service the emerging Asian market itself. Many believe this is the thin end of the wedge and is a precursor to the wholesale abandonment of pen manufacturing in the west completely. This would follow in the footsteps of what has happened in the promotional pens and promotional items market in general where the vast majority of manufacturing is now carried out in either India or China.
So what was so attractive to western importers that allowed Chinese manufacturers of promotional pens to flourish? Here we look at the main reasons.
1. Labour Costs: There was a time when Chinese labour costs were as low as 5% of western costs and this made the unit costs of promotional pens very low, as much of the assembly was by hand and labour intensive. In the west any hand assembly was prohibitively expensive and as a consequence much of the assembly was done using very expensive dedicated fully automatic lines. The cost of designing, building and maintaining these lines is extremely high and must be reflected in the unit-selling price. This is not a consideration where Chinese promotional pens are concerned because all pens are hand-assembled and consequently prices are much lower.
2. Tooling Charges: It would typically cost between A�50,000 to A�120,000 for a quality toolset to manufacture promotional pens when moulded in Europe or America. This cost is high because of the length of time that is needed to make a tool capable of producing up to 36 pen barrels in one mould. This requires high levels of precision so that the tool operates efficiently, with little downtime and minimal maintenance so that unit costs can be controlled. Labour costs are not a major consideration for Chinese manufacturers so they could afford to make several small tools capable of moulding, say, 4 pens at a time. These tools wear out relatively quickly but their replacement costs are negligible and consequently there is no need for them to amortise this cost into the unit cost of the promotional pen.
